Douro Historical Train

CP’s Douro Historical Train is a seasonal Régua–Tua return experience using restored early-20th-century carriages, regional music and stops in Pinhão and Tua. For 2026, a historic 1960s diesel replaces the usual steam locomotive.

On board

This is a preserved railway run for its own sake, so the journey deliberately feels older and slower than modern rail. At a few hours between Peso da Régua and Tua, it is long enough to feel like a journey and short enough to watch the whole of it without losing concentration. There are few intermediate calls, so the run feels continuous once it is underway.

Douro Line

The working Douro Line carries ordinary CP trains from Porto deep into the wine valley through Régua, Pinhão and Tua to Pocinho, following the river past terraces and quintas for hours.
